Sperm
The male reproductive cells or gametes involved in sexual reproduction, capable of fertilizing an ovum to produce offspring.
Fertilization
The process by which a sperm cell unites with an egg cell to form a zygote, initiating the development of a new organism.
Relaxin
A hormone produced by the placenta in the later months of pregnancy that increases flexibility in the ligaments and joints of the pelvic area. In men, relaxin is contained in semen, where it assists in sperm motility.
Uterus
A major female hormone-responsive reproductive sex organ of most mammals, including humans, where offspring are conceived and in which they gestate before birth.
